Succession ended its four-season run last year with a whole pile of Emmy victories to go with its high ratings and universal acclaim, but until now the only way to watch this series has been to stream it from Max, watch on actual cable, pay too much for your own streaming copy from a digital retailer, or opt for a DVD set. It's rare to see a show as big as Succession release on DVD without a Blu-ray version as well. But that's going to change soon, because HBO is going to be releasing Succession: The Complete Series on Blu-ray, and you can preorder it right now. Unsurprisingly, it's more expensive than the DVD version, which is currently on sale for $45 at Amazon, but it'll offer a better overall viewing experience.

Succession is the story of Logan Roy, head of one of the world's largest media conglomerates, who just announced his imminent retirement. Now his kids, and more than a few others, have to spend four seasons jockeying for position in hopes of becoming the new boss while also earning a little bit of love from daddy.

While there's no release date yet for this set, it's expected to arrive sometime this year. As the title indicates, the set will include all four brilliant seasons of this darkly comic family drama, along with a variety of extras to go with.
